网站和优化 · 10 10 月, 2024

WordPress 教程:如何實現 WordPress 和 WooCommerce 文章重新排序

WordPress 教程:如何實現 WordPress 和 WooCommerce 文章重新排序

在當今的數字時代,網站的內容管理變得越來越重要。對於使用 WordPress 和 WooCommerce 的網站來說,文章的排序不僅影響用戶體驗,還會影響 SEO 排名。本文將介紹如何在 WordPress 和 WooCommerce 中實現文章的重新排序,幫助您更好地管理網站內容。

為什麼需要重新排序文章?

重新排序文章的原因有很多,主要包括:

  • 提升用戶體驗:通過將最重要或最新的文章放在顯眼的位置,可以提高用戶的瀏覽體驗。
  • 增強 SEO 效果:搜索引擎通常會優先考慮最新或最相關的內容,重新排序可以幫助提高網站的可見性。
  • 促進銷售:在 WooCommerce 中,將特定產品或促銷活動的文章放在前面,可以有效吸引顧客的注意。

如何在 WordPress 中重新排序文章

使用拖放功能

WordPress 提供了一個簡單的拖放功能來重新排序文章。您可以按照以下步驟操作:

  1. 登錄到您的 WordPress 後台。
  2. 導航到 文章 > 所有文章
  3. 在文章列表中,您可以直接拖動文章到您想要的位置。
  4. 完成後,系統會自動保存您的更改。

使用插件

如果您需要更高級的排序功能,可以考慮使用插件。以下是一些推薦的插件:

  • Post Types Order:這個插件允許您使用拖放功能來重新排序任何自定義文章類型。
  • Simple Custom Post Order:這是一個輕量級的插件,支持自定義文章類型的排序。

如何在 WooCommerce 中重新排序產品

使用 WooCommerce 的內建功能

WooCommerce 也提供了內建的產品排序功能。您可以按照以下步驟操作:

  1. 登錄到您的 WordPress 後台。
  2. 導航到 產品 > 所有產品
  3. 在產品列表中,您可以使用拖放功能來重新排序產品。
  4. 完成後,系統會自動保存您的更改。

使用自定義排序

如果您需要更靈活的排序選項,可以考慮使用自定義排序。以下是一個簡單的代碼示例,您可以將其添加到主題的 functions.php 文件中:


function custom_product_order($query) {
    if (!is_admin() && $query->is_main_query() && is_shop()) {
        $query->set('orderby', 'menu_order');
        $query->set('order', 'ASC');
    }
}
add_action('pre_get_posts', 'custom_product_order');

這段代碼將在 WooCommerce 商店頁面上根據產品的菜單順序進行排序。

總結

重新排序 WordPress 和 WooCommerce 中的文章和產品是一個簡單但有效的管理策略。無論是使用內建的拖放功能還是安裝插件,您都可以輕鬆地根據需要調整內容的顯示順序。這不僅能提升用戶體驗,還能增強網站的 SEO 效果。

如果您正在尋找穩定的 香港 VPS 解決方案來支持您的 WordPress 和 WooCommerce 網站,Server.HK 提供多種選擇,滿足不同需求。無論是小型商業網站還是大型電子商務平台,我們的 云服务器 都能為您提供強大的支持。